Abstract
According to one embodiment, a high-frequency amplifier includes an active element and an output matching circuit. The active element is provided on a substrate. The active element is configured to amplify a signal having a frequency band. The active element includes a cell region. The output matching circuit is connected to the active element. The output matching circuit includes a wire, a transmission line and an output terminal. The wire includes an input end and an output end. The input end of the wire is connected to an output part of the cell region of the active element. The transmission line is provided on the substrate. The transmission line includes an input part and an output part. The input part of the transmission line is connected to the output end of the wire. The output terminal is provided on the substrate.
